DetailsDescription:
PlasmaShell always uses CPU by 12-20% and never stops. Additional info: * package: extra/plasma-desktop 5.2.0-2 * latest update Steps to reproduce: 1. Run KF5 by SDDM 2. Launch Kontact, Dolphin, Konsole 3. Wait for few minutes |
